Entering size and color attributes for kids optical frames in POS sounds simple — until a shipment from our factory arrives and the retailer’s system has no clean place to put the data.

To enter size and color attributes for kids optical frames in POS, create a Size attribute using eye size, bridge width, and temple length in millimeters, create a Color attribute using manufacturer color codes plus friendly names, then combine them into matrix variants so each size-color combination becomes one sellable SKU.

That is the short answer. But kids’ frames are not t-shirts. Fit depends on real frame measurements, and colorways must match what your supplier actually ships SKU codes 1. Below, I will walk through what to expect from a manufacturer, how to structure SKUs, which sizing standards to follow, and how far customization can go.

What Size and Color Options Should I Expect When Sourcing Kids Optical Frames from a Manufacturer?

A buyer from Australia once asked me why the same style number arrived in three different bridge widths. The answer: kids' frames scale by age group, not by a single size label.

Expect each kids optical frame style to come in one to three sizes, defined by eye size, bridge width, and temple length in millimeters, plus four to eight colorways per style, each identified by a manufacturer color code such as C1 or C2 rather than a plain color name.

At our Taizhou factory, we keep around 800 existing styles in our eyewear product catalog, and almost every kids optical frame follows the same logic. A style has a model number. Under that model number sit sizes and colorways. Your POS setup should mirror this structure, because your reorders will reference it.

The Three Core Frame Measurements

Optical size is not one number. It is a set of frame measurements, usually printed on the temple arm:

Measurement What It Controls Typical Kids Range
Eye size (A) Lens width and overall frame scale 40–48 mm
Bridge width (DBL) How the frame sits on the nose 14–18 mm
Temple length Grip behind the ears 120–135 mm

Some optical POS software also tracks lens height (B measurement) and total frame width. If your system allows it, capture those too. They help with lens ordering and dispensing accuracy.

How Colorways Arrive from the Factory

Take one of our TR90 kids optical frames 2 as an example. A glossy black front with royal blue silicone temple tips might be coded C1. A translucent blush-pink acetate-look version of the same shape might be C4. Both are the same model. If your POS only stores "black" and "pink," your reorder email to us becomes a guessing game. Store the code and the friendly name together. That single habit prevents most sourcing mix-ups I see, and it keeps your eyewear inventory management 3 aligned with the factory's packing lists from day one.

How Do I Organize SKUs for Different Frame Sizes and Colors Before Listing Them in My POS System?

One trade-off comes up in nearly every onboarding call with new brand clients: simple size labels are faster at the counter, but detailed measurements prevent wrong dispensing. Your SKU logic has to serve both.

Organize kids frame SKUs as a matrix: one parent product per model, with child variants for each real size-color combination. Build SKU codes from model, size, and color code — for example, OK1023-46-C1 — so every variant is unique, scannable, and traceable back to the supplier.

When we prepare a shipment, every carton carries a barcode tied to a model-size-color combination. Retailers who mirror that structure in their POS receive stock in minutes. Retailers who lump everything under one item spend an afternoon counting frames by hand. Good product variant management 5 starts before the goods arrive.

A Practical SKU Structure

Here is a SKU generation pattern that works in most POS platforms:

SKU Segment Example Source
Model number OK1023 Manufacturer style code
Eye size 46 Printed frame measurement
Color code C1 Manufacturer colorway code
Full SKU OK1023-46-C1 Combined variant identifier

The Matrix Setup Workflow

Most modern systems support matrix or variant products. The workflow is consistent across platforms:

  1. Create the attribute definitions — Size and Color — in the POS back office.
  2. Add only the values you actually stock. Duplicate values are usually rejected by the system anyway.
  3. Assign both attributes to the parent product.
  4. Generate variants, then delete impossible combinations. If the pink colorway only comes in size 44, do not let a 48-pink ghost SKU exist.
  5. Attach barcodes to each variant so barcode scanning works at receiving and at the sale.

Some retailers push back here. They want every measurement stored as its own attribute. I understand the instinct, but it slows the counter down. The practical balance: use size and color as the two variant axes, and store DBL, temple length, and lens height as informational fields on the variant. Staff pick fast; the technical data stays available for lens lab integration and reorders. Test the search screen before you roll this out to the full catalog — if staff cannot find the frame in five seconds, simplify.

Which Sizing Standards Should I Follow When Setting Up Kids Optical Frame Attributes for Different Age Groups?

Early in my time selling into Japan and Europe, I learned a hard lesson: an age label on a box is a marketing suggestion, while the millimeter measurements are the contract. Your POS should treat them the same way.

Follow millimeter-based optical sizing as your primary standard — eye size, DBL, and temple length — and use age-group labels only as a secondary, customer-facing guide. Typical bands are 40–43 mm eye size for ages 2–5, 44–46 mm for 5–8, and 47–49 mm for 8–12.

Children's faces vary widely within any age band. Our flexible TR90 and TPEE frames forgive some fit error because the material bends and recovers, but no material fixes a bridge that is 4 mm too wide. So the POS attribute setup should anchor to measurements, with age as a helper.

A Reference Sizing Table for POS Setup

Age Group Label Eye Size (A) Bridge (DBL) Temple Length Notes for Staff
Toddler (2–5) 40–43 mm 14–15 mm 120–125 mm Look for flatter, wider bridge fit
Young child (5–8) 44–46 mm 15–16 mm 125–130 mm Most common reorder band
Older child (8–12) 47–49 mm 16–18 mm 130–135 mm Overlaps with petite adult sizing

Keep Age Labels and Measurements Separate

Do not merge them into one attribute value like "Small (3-5yrs, 42mm)." It looks helpful, but it breaks filtering, confuses SKU generation, and makes future edits painful. Instead, set Size to the eye size value, and add an "Age Guide" custom field or tag. Optical practice management systems often link the chosen frame to customer prescription data, including pupillary distance 6, and that linkage depends on clean measurement fields — not a mixed text string. Store everything in millimeters, consistently, across the whole catalog. If one style uses "46" and another uses "46mm" and a third uses "Medium," your reports and reorders will fracture into three inconsistent groups. Pick one convention on day one and enforce it.

Can I Customize Color Codes and Size Labels to Match My Brand When Working with an OEM Supplier?

A children's brand from Europe recently asked us to rename our C1–C6 colorways to match their playful in-house palette — "Midnight Rocket" instead of C1 black-blue. We said yes, with one condition worth explaining.

Yes. A capable OEM supplier can print your branded color names and size labels on temples, tags, and packaging, and supply a mapping sheet linking your labels to factory codes. Your POS should store both: your brand label for customers, the factory code for reorders.

What Can Be Customized

  • Colorway names printed on hang tags, boxes, and temple interiors.
  • Custom Pantone-matched colors for TR90 fronts and TPEE temple tips, beyond our stock palette.
  • Size labels — some brands prefer S/M/L on packaging while keeping millimeter marks on the frame itself.
  • Barcodes pre-printed at the factory using your SKU logic, so barcode scanning at receiving matches your POS from carton one.

The Mapping Sheet Is Non-Negotiable

The condition I mentioned: every custom label must map back to a factory code on a shared spreadsheet. When you email us "Midnight Rocket, size M, 300 units," we translate it instantly to model-46-C1 and production starts without a clarification loop. Skip the mapping sheet, and a two-day order confirmation becomes a two-week back-and-forth. Load both identifiers into your POS: brand name in the display field, factory code in the supplier-reference field. This dual-coding also protects real-time stock visibility across multiple store locations, because transfers and reorders always resolve to one unambiguous variant. One more objection I hear: "custom codes lock us into one supplier." In practice, the opposite is true. A clean mapping sheet makes your data portable — you can hand it to any factory and get comparable quotes, while a POS full of vague color names cannot travel anywhere.
